Why Bathroom Organization Fails

Bathrooms are small, awkwardly shaped, and packed with items we use daily. Without intentional systems, clutter accumulates fast.

The problem: Most people try to organize bathroom items horizontally (counter space, drawer space). But bathrooms need vertical thinking—walls, doors, and cabinet height.

What changed for me: I maximized every vertical inch and created designated zones for morning routine, skincare, and storage.

Small Bathroom-Specific Tips

If you have limited space:
  1. Go vertical: Over-toilet rack, wall shelves, tall cabinets

  2. Use doors: Over-door hooks and organizers

  3. Clear out half your products: Do you really need 12 lotions?

  4. Uniform containers: Makes small spaces look bigger

  5. Light colors: White, clear organizers feel more spacious

If you share a bathroom:
  1. Designated drawers: Each person gets their own

  2. Color-coded towels: Everyone knows which is theirs

  3. Individual caddies: Portable and keeps items separate

  4. Countertop trays: Each person's daily items in one tray

Products I Regret Buying

Suction cup organizers: Fall off constantly. Not worth the frustration.

Too many tiny containers: Looks cute but becomes clutter. Stick with what you actually need.

Cheap plastic drawers: Cracked within months. Invest in quality storage.

Common Bathroom Organization Questions

Q: How do I organize a bathroom with no counter space?
A: Wall shelves, over-toilet storage, and drawer organizers become your best friends. Keep daily items in a caddy you can pull out when needed.

Q: What about cleaning products?
A: Under-sink organizer with a caddy for most-used items. Keep the caddy portable so you can carry supplies to other rooms.

Q: How do I keep it organized with kids?
A: Low hooks for their towels, designated drawer or bin for their items, and step stool they can put away themselves.

Q: Should I store makeup in the bathroom?
A: Humidity can shorten makeup life. If possible, store in bedroom. If not, use airtight containers.
